The issue facing driver training and education, is how to develop programs that will reduce the crashes of novice drivers and improve driving efficiency within the transportation system of today and the future. A driver training and education program appropriately designed for novices and part of a graduated licensing system has the potential to enhance the crash reduction of the licensing system. Graduated driver licensing systems have proven crash reduction potential. There is no single solution to this problem, but there are several approaches that can definitely help.
